North County Vaccine Clinics - Fall 2023

Fall 2023 Flu and COVID Vaccine clinics - Several Locations Available; See Attached Flyers

Your school nurses, senior centers and libraries have all collaborated to host a number of clinics this fall. These clinics are the “mobile vaccine” clinics, where an external vaccine provider, Cataldo Ambulance, will come to provide staff and vaccine.

One important message is this: It is incredibly important that folks preregister. Although limited walk-in vaccine will be available, registering allows folks to reserve their dose(s)!

FRCOG public health nurses will bring flu vaccine to their Walk-In Wellness hours throughout the fall and are eager to provide in-home vaccine for those who are unable to leave their homes or find it incredibly difficult to access vaccine elsewhere.
